Electric portable air compressor

November 1, 2016  By Atlas Copco Construction Equipment



Nov. 1, 2016 – Atlas Copco Construction Equipment’s XATS 900E electric portable air compressor features four preset flow and pressure selections to give contractors versatility and rental centres greater flexibility in their fleet offering. 

The compressor features a high-efficiency 160-kilowatt WEG 22 motor. Despite the industry-wide focus on Tier 4 Final regulations, the XATS 900E’s electric motor exempts it from emission regulations, so it’s usable in any state, province or territory. In addition, the electric motor gives contractors a cost-effective alternative to traditional diesel-fuelled air compressors because electricity prices are less volatile than fuel costs. The XATS 900E operates at a very quiet 73 decibels — about the same as a vacuum cleaner — which allows contractors to work in noise-sensitive areas, such as near hospitals or schools. 

Atlas Copco designed the XATS 900E for dependable operation and high-quality results. For example, its Star-Delta starter reduces the starting current protecting the compressor, and has no limits on number of starts. The compressor comes standard equipped with an aftercooler and water separator with fine filters to reduce moisture as well as oil carry-over in the output air, and by-pass should non-filtered air be desired.
